5 Typical Remote Work Mistakes (and How in Prevent It)
Transitioning to a remote lifestyle can be fantastic , but it’s simple to make a few significant missteps. Here are several typical frequent pitfalls people encounter, coupled with useful tips to steer away them . Initially , blurring the lines between professional and personal life is a big issue; set separate professional hours and adhere with them . Second , inadequate of structure can lead toward delay and lower productivity . Implement time blocking and list tasks . Subsequently, detachment is a genuine concern; arrange periodic virtual calls with coworkers . Then , neglecting to remember pauses can exhaust you empty ; include short walks and activities . Ultimately, not having a dedicated zone can hinder the focus ; set up a peaceful space free of distractions .
- Set limits among professional and personal life.
- Rank responsibilities and remain to a time block.
- Engage with peers online .
- Schedule periodic breaks .
- Designate an appropriate workspace .

Work From Home Burnout: Signs, Prevention, and Recovery
The change to working from your residence can bring fantastic benefits , but it also poses a real risk of depletion. Spotting the red flags is essential ; these can feature persistent fatigue , problems focusing , increased irritability, and a reduction of drive. Preventing burnout demands creating clear limits between work and leisure time, incorporating regular breaks , and prioritizing self-care. Recuperation from burnout could include needing time off, finding support from loved ones or a therapist , and reassessing your responsibilities and total approach to your employment.

Home Office Tax Deductions : What You Can Claim
Navigating home-based tax credits can feel tricky , but understanding what you can claim is vital . You may be able to deduct expenses related to your designated area, such as a portion of your mortgage interest , power, web access , and office materials. To meet the requirements, the area generally must be used exclusively and consistently for your business activities. Keep accurate records of all expenditures – receipts is key! Consult a tax advisor for personalized guidance based on your specific circumstances.
